Latest Patents
Jinshik Bae's latest patents include a method for preloading applications and an electronic device that supports this functionality. The first patent describes an electronic device that features a housing with a flexible display. This display can expand or reduce its area based on the movement of the second housing relative to the first. The processor within the device identifies changes in the display area and determines which application to preload based on this size. This innovative approach allows for a more efficient execution of applications when needed.
The second patent involves an electronic device designed to control a processing unit based on the time spent generating frames. This device includes a memory, a display, and a multi-core processor. The processor identifies the time taken to generate frames and adjusts the operation of its cores accordingly. This ensures optimal performance and responsiveness in generating display frames, enhancing the overall user experience.
